Crooked Lake Elementary School, located at 2939 Bunker Lake Blvd NW in Andover, Minnesota, is a part of the Anoka-Hennepin School District. The school is committed to providing a supportive and engaging learning environment for its students. Recently, the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) announced the SUN Bucks program, an income-based food support program that provides families with $120 per eligible school-aged child to buy groceries during the summer. The Anoka-Hennepin School District, including Crooked Lake Elementary, participates in the USDA Summer Food Service Program, offering free meals to all children 18 and under during the summer. The district values parent and guardian input, regularly seeking feedback to improve services to students and families. Crooked Lake Elementary School and the Anoka-Hennepin School District have been recognized for their efforts in communication and community engagement, earning awards from the National School Public Relations Association. The school district has also taken steps to address COVID-19, including offering vaccination options and at-home test kits for students.
